RE: The tariff classification of a multifunction machine from China

Dear Ms. Kittel,

In your letter dated December 14, 2005, you requested a tariff classification ruling on behalf of Target Stores of Minneapolis, Minnesota.

The item concerned is the Gentle Vibrations 3-in-1 Crib Soother (Y3094). It is a two-part item: the first part is a U-shaped, battery-operated apparatus with ten buttons on top and a framed light angled near its bottom; it measures approximately 6 ½” in length X 4 ¼” in width. The second part is an oval-shaped, hard plastic disc which measures approximately 7” in length X 3 ¾” in width.

The purpose of the item is to play sounds, provide a nightlight and vibrate the mattress for an infant in a crib. These actions are intended to encourage the infant to fall, and stay, asleep.

Classification of goods in the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S) is governed by the General Rules of Interpretation (GRIs). GRI 1. states, “ ... classification shall be determined according to the terms of the headings ... “. Heading 8543 provides for “Electrical machines and apparatus, having individual functions, not specified or included elsewhere ... “.

General Note 3. (h) (vi) to the HTS states, “ ... a reference to “headings” encompasses subheadings indented thereunder.”.

The applicable subheading for the Gentle Vibrations 3-in-1 Crib Soother (Y3094) will be 8543.89.9695,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for “Electrical machines and apparatus, having individual functions, not specified or included elsewhere ... : Other machines and apparatus: Other: Other: Other: Other: Other”. The rate of duty will be 2.6%.
